Headline news for the 25th Carole Nash Classic Motorcycle Mechanics Show, being held over October 13/14, at Staffordshire County Showground, is the appearance of 11 Cagiva ex-GP racers being displayed together, on the central Mortons’ stand. Responsible for some of the most beautiful racers from the late 1980s and 1990s, Cagiva strived to break the Japanese dominance, employing top level riders including Randy Mamola, Eddie Lawson and John Kocinski, with the latter two managing to get the machines into the winner’s circle, but alas, never delivering a 500cc world championship. Star names expected to attend the show include GP world champions Jon Ekerold and Paolo Bianhci, plus ex-WSBK start and twice endurance world champion Terry Rymer.
